Output e3ffa54f998f4f03ddad9e4d5f7126d0796c80248efa9afb87df8561e916e5cd:0

value
576895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b65c8a7b0fca566fdd19136e456b242fad20f0da OP_EQUAL
address
3JKFmKB2n8EogdrX5cVZMuWxR5mzWHWjj3
transaction
e3ffa54f998f4f03ddad9e4d5f7126d0796c80248efa9afb87df8561e916e5cd
confirmations
162073
spent
true